Before implementation, ARM’s customers had to rely heavily on FieldApplication Engineers for IP selection.
This involved complex consultations,iterative back‑and‑forth,and long decision cycles.
Users could not independentlyexplore ARM’s extensive IP catalogue or assess compatibility fortheir SoC designs.
The process slowed adoption,increased engineering overhead, and created friction in the earlystages of product evaluation.
ARM needed a cloud platform that simplified the journey from exploration to configuration to simulation.

Solution
Innovify conducted an in-depth discovery workshop with ARM to map the current process, define the future vision, and identify opportunities for productisation.
A Unified, Cloud-Native SoC Design System
Innovify engineered a complete cloud solution that allowed users to:
- Search and compare ARM IP
- Configure IP components based on project requirements
- Simulate functionality before committing to design
- Integrate selected IP into their SoC architecture
All within a single, seamless environment.
